Craig Inglis

Craig started his career in 1992 as a marketing graduate trainee at Thomson Holidays, leading to a role as a Product Manager. Craig joined Virgin in 1997 as a Product Manager and after launching thetrainline.com, he rose to become Sales and Marketing Director of Virgin Trains. He joined John Lewis in March 2008, where as Marketing Director he has presided over an overhaul of the retailer’s customer and marketing strategies, helping to drive six consecutive years of sales growth and market share gains in every category. He is probably best known for delivering a number of high profile campaigns including the much talked about ‘Always A Woman’ in 2010 to re-launch John Lewis’s ‘Never Knowingly Undersold’ policy, as well as a series of increasingly famous Christmas campaigns like ‘The Long Wait’, ‘The Snowman’s Journey’ and the most talked about campaign of 2014, ‘The Bear and The Hare’.
